Gutter Blockage Removal in Longmont, CO
Gutter blockage removal services focus on clearing debris such as leaves, twigs, dirt, and other obstructions that can accumulate in gutters and downspouts. These services are essential for maintaining proper water flow and preventing water damage to the roof, siding, foundation, and landscaping. Projects typically include inspecting the entire gutter system, removing blockages, flushing out the gutters, and ensuring that water can drain freely. Homeowners often seek this service after noticing overflowing gutters, water pooling near the foundation, or as part of routine maintenance to avoid more costly repairs caused by neglected drainage systems.
Before requesting gutter blockage removal,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the clogging, the condition of their gutters, and whether any repairs or replacements might be necessary. It’s also helpful to know if the service includes a thorough inspection of the entire gutter system to identify potential issues such as leaks or sagging. Clarifying what materials and tools will be used, as well as any recommended follow-up maintenance, can assist homeowners in planning for ongoing gutter care and ensuring their property remains protected from water-related damage.

Gutter Blockage Removal Questions
What causes gutter blockages? Leaves, twigs, and debris can accumulate in gutters, leading to blockages that prevent proper water flow.
How can I tell if my gutters are clogged? Signs include overflowing water during rain, sagging gutters, or water pooling around the foundation.
What are the risks of ignoring gutter blockages? Ignored blockages can cause water damage, foundation issues, and pest infestations around the property.
What methods are used to remove gutter blockages? Techniques include manual removal of debris and flushing gutters with water to clear obstructions.
